Satvick Acharya is a rising researcher at the intersection of intelligent transportation systems and machine learning safety. His primary focus lies in enhancing the resilience of Connected Autonomous Vehicle (CAV) platoons, specifically addressing the critical challenge of fault classification in mixed-traffic environments where autonomous and human-driven vehicles coexist. In his seminal 2023 work, "Multi-Head Attention Machine Learning for Fault Classification in Mixed Autonomous and Human-Driven Vehicle Platoons," Acharya pioneered the use of attention-based deep learning to distinguish between cyber-physical faults and human-induced errors—a distinction vital for deploying appropriate fault resolution strategies. This paper has already garnered 3 citations, signaling growing interest in his approach. By targeting vulnerabilities across all layers of the platoon system, from communication to control, Acharya’s research directly contributes to safer, more robust autonomous mobility.
